Canada finalizes negotiations to participate in the E.U. Defence Program.
Canada is the only non European country allowed to join.
www.cpac.ca/headline-pol...
Canada Reaches Deal to Participate in E.U. Defence Program – December 1, 2025
Speaking with reporters on Parliament Hill, Defence Minister David McGuinty confirms the conclusion of negotiations for Canada’s participation in the European Union’s Security Action for Europe (SAFE)...

‘It’s not a loophole:’ Toronto has plans to install 20 km of new bike lanes despite provincial legislation
Toronto has plans to install 20 km of new bike lanes despite provincial legislation
Toronto has found a way to install 20 kilometres of new bike lanes while still complying with provincial legislation that places significant restrictions on new cycling infrastructure.

This river sends 500 billion microplastics into Lake Ontario each year: study
This river sends 500 billion microplastics into Lake Ontario each year: study
A new study of one of Canada’s most urbanized rivers suggests it dumps the equivalent of about 18 cars worth of microplastics into Lake Ontario every year, a finding that shocked the lead author and underscored efforts to cut down on pollution.
